San Diego FC welcome Colorado Rapids to Snapdragon Stadium on August 22 for a Western Conference clash with playoff positioning on the line. The hosts, priced at 1.96, carry the weight of a 1-0 loss to this same Rapids side less than a month ago, adding a revenge narrative to an already high-stakes evening in MLS action.
Projected final score: 1-0
San Diego's home advantage at Snapdragon Stadium, combined with Colorado's damning 2W-1D-7L away record in 2026 MLS, tilts this firmly toward the hosts. With eight Rapids players unavailable and San Diego recording back-to-back clean sheets, 1.96 looks compelling for a narrow home victory built on defensive solidity rather than attacking flair.
A low-scoring outcome is strongly supported by the context here. Colorado have conceded just 0.4 goals per match in their last five, while San Diego's attack may be blunted by Ingvartsen's doubtful status and questions over Dreyer's availability. Both sides' defensive form points clearly toward 2.42, making a tight 1-0 the most logical result.

Match Analysis
San Diego enter this Western Conference clash as narrow home favourites at 1.96, backed by two consecutive clean sheets and a potent attack averaging 1.4 goals per match across their last five outings at Snapdragon Stadium.
- Two consecutive clean sheets highlight San Diego's defensive discipline heading into this fixture.
- 1.4 goals per match in the last five games reflects a sharp and consistent attacking output.
- Dreyer has recorded 20 goals and 20 assists in just 36 MLS matches, providing elite creative threat.
- Home advantage at Snapdragon adds significant weight, with Colorado's road record a damning 2W-1D-7L in 2026.
Colorado Rapids arrive as road underdogs at 3.46, carrying a depleted squad stripped of eight key players including goalkeeper Steffen and midfielder Ronan, making a positive result in San Diego an exceptionally difficult proposition despite their counter-attacking capabilities.
- 2W-1D-7L away in 2026 makes Colorado one of the worst travelling sides in the Western Conference.
- Eight players absent, including Steffen, Travis, Ronan and Atencio, severely limits squad depth and balance.
- Just 1.0 goal per match in the last five games exposes a blunt and unreliable attacking output on the road.
Key point: With Colorado conceding just 0.4 goals per match recently and San Diego potentially missing both Dreyer and Ingvartsen, a tight low-scoring contest makes the under 2.5 goals market worth serious consideration.
